About the Item

This beautiful carved Renaissance front section was a part of a built in cabinet. The carvings are typical for Bretagne area in France and it can be dated mid-17th century. The carvings depicts classical floral elements, a cherub and classical architectural elements. This type of furniture was usually meant for storing food and beverages. It is completely made in solid oak and it has a beautiful stained and waxed finish. The two vertical outer pieces of the framework are renewed and the whole thing has been carefully checked in our workshop. Ready for use.

Antique 17th Century Dutch Renaissance Dresser of Buffet in Oak and Walnut
Located in Casteren, NL
This rare and rich decorated Renaissance dresser was made during the Dutch Golden age in the southern part of the Netherlands currently Belgium. It was made around 1670 and most likely in Antwerp. The dresser was made in the finest quality watered European oak and decorated geometric-shaped walnut veneer panels. The cabinet has two wide doors and two drawers above. The drawers are flanked by carved lion heads with brass rings. The right drawer is equipped with an authentic working lock and key. The doors are decorated with geometrical star-like walnut inlaid raised panels. The doors are flanked by large twisted Solomonic columns decorated with brass nails. The righthand door features its authentic lock and key with a brass ajour cut keyplate. The dresser has a wax finish with a great patina built up over 350 years. This piece of furniture was made by highly skilled craftsmen by the use of the best materials available. It is among the best furniture that was produced during the golden age and even now its craftsmanship is unprecedented. The dresser is highly original and in perfect shape for a piece of furniture over 350 years old. It was gently cleaned in our atelier and a new protective wax coat was applied.
